Choosing to not remove MSTeams in default mode does not work

Open ryancausey opened this issue 2 weeks ago • 2 comments

Checklist

  • [x] I have searched for existing issues/discussions and didn't find any similar ones.
  • [x] I haven't used any other scripts, tools or programs that might have caused this issue.

Windows version

Windows 11 24H2

Script mode/options

Default mode with manual app removal selection

Describe the issue

When I ran the script and manually selected to not remove MSTeams as I still need it for work, it instead ended up removing MSTeams anyways.

Steps to reproduce

  1. run script in default mode.
  2. follow prompt to manually select which apps to remove.
  3. continue the default mode after selecting which apps to remove.
